Another way to prepare for a power outage is to ensure that you have a list of all the things in your home that depend on electricity. Consult your physician about a power outage plan for medical devices that run on electricity and refrigerated medications. Find out how long they can be stored at higher temperatures and get specific instructions for any medications that are critical for your daily life. It's also a good idea to store up on canned goods and non-perishable items to last through the outage. This will reduce the chance of spoiling and will be an essential resource should you need to evacuate your home or move to shelter during a prolonged outage. Overloaded Outlets Overloaded outlets can lead to serious electrical issues for homeowners. It happens when too many appliances are connected to a single outlet, resulting in overheating of wires and even a fire. It is essential that everyone in the household is aware of the appropriate amperage their circuit breakers and fuse can handle. This can prevent electrical fires and the overheating of wires. A professional electrician can help determine the current electrical rating of your home. They can also make recommendations regarding how to safely install new outlets or expand existing ones so you don't overtax your current system. Overloaded outlets can cause issues for older homes, particularly when they don't have enough outlets that can accommodate modern appliances. This is especially the case during the holiday season when more lights and decorations are powered up than usual. To ensure that your outlet is not overloaded, make sure you only plug in appliances that are designed to be used on the outlet. Do not daisy-chain extension cords onto power strips and plugging them into power strips. This can cause the outlet to heat up quickly. Another safety precaution is to avoid overloading your outlet with high-wattage appliances such as hair dryers or microwaves. If you must use such devices, then make sure you limit your use to only occasional periods of high demand. It's a good idea to examine your electrical outlets for indications of overheating. Hot or warm outlet covers are a clear sign that they are required to be inspected. If you hear a booming sound from an outlet or you notice the smell of burning emanating from the outlet or switch is the time to contact a licensed electrician.
